    #ComicBytes: 5 Marvel characters who wielded Infinity Gauntlet of Thanos

    #ComicBytes: 5 Marvel characters who wielded Infinity Gauntlet of Thanos

    By Shuvrajit Das Biswas
    Oct 02, 2018
    05:52 pm

    What's the story

    The mad titan Thanos was the antagonist in Infinity War. Though the Avengers tried their best, he still managed to erase half the world's population.

    His power came from the Infinity Gauntlet that he wore. The gauntlet contained all the Infinity Stones, essentially elevating him to the level of 'God'.

    However, he is not the only Marvel character who has witnessed its power.

    Information

    A little about the Infinity Gauntlet

    The Infinity Gauntlet was first seen in the possession of Thanos in Marvel's films and the comics. The gauntlet is notably used to channel the power of the six Infinity Gems. The gems are, as we know, soul, power, time, reality, mind and space.

    Santa Claus

    Christmas with a chance of infinite power

    Unsurprisingly, Santa Claus exists in the Marvel Universe.

    In one of the comics following Secret Invasion, where Skrulls disguised themselves as earth's residents, Santa discovered his reindeer were also Skrulls.

    He asked help from Illuminati, a group including Black Panther, Iron Man, Namor, and others.

    However, the Infinity Gauntlet's power corrupted Santa and Namor had to throw a snowball at him to retrieve it.

    Hulk

    The king of smashing becomes a God

    The Hulk is famous for his immense strength even without the Infinity Gauntlet.

    In Marvel's Ultimate Universe, Hulk briefly wielded two Infinity Gauntlets. Yes, you read that right. There are two gauntlets and eight infinity stones in that universe.

    Luckily, not all stones were equipped and other Avengers, or Ultimates as they are called, managed to apprehend Hulk before he started a smashing spree.

    Iron Man

    The stuff heroes are made of

    In one of the Avengers issues, a villain called The Hood tries to use the Infinity Gauntlet for nefarious plans.

    As the Avengers and Illuminati gather to stop him, Iron Man manages to wield the gauntlet during battle.

    He quickly restores order and to the credit of Tony Stark, he does not let the power corrupt him and gives up the gauntlet immediately after.

    Captain America

    Every soldier can cast the shadow of a hero

    If anyone could resist the corrupting power of the Infinity Gauntlet, it had to be Captain America.

    Steve Rogers joined the Illuminati as their moral compass. When earth faced the threat of destruction, Captain put on the gauntlet to save the day.

    He did manage to avoid the catastrophe, but apparently destroyed five of the six infinity stones.

    Nonetheless, Cap deserves applause.

    Adam Warlock

    A contender for the Infinity Gauntlet

    In the comics, Adam Warlock saves the day as Thanos tries to execute his monstrous plan using the Infinity Gauntlet.

    An extremely powerful being, Warlock steals the gauntlet from Thanos and carries it to safety.

    He splits up the stones among members of the Infinity Watch, including Gamora and Drax.

    If only, Warlock had appeared in the new Infinity War film as well.

    Do you know?

    A notable mention of our beloved anti-hero

    Among the list of characters who wore the Infinity Gauntlet, Deadpool deserves special mention. While everyone used the gauntlet to destroy or save the universe, Deadpool stole the gauntlet from Thanos to organize a comedy roast where he could make fun of all Marvel characters.
